SUSPENDED The job was suspended by the F11–Suspend function on the Job Status
screen. To activate the job, use the F10–Activate function on that screen.
TAPE The job has the TAPEDRIVES attribute and requires more drives than are
available. For more information on this attribute, see Job Info
on
page 6-120.
The job remains in the TAPE state after the required drives become
available if either of these conditions exists:
•
No executor is available for the job’s class.
•
The job’s class has the attribute INITIATION OFF. This attribute
prevents jobs belonging to the class from running. To make the jobs
available for execution, use the Class Details screen to set the
attribute to INITIATION ON.
TIME The job has one of these attributes specifying the time it is to run: AFTER,
AT, CALENDAR, EVERY, WAIT. When the attribute condition is satisfied,
the state changes to one of:
•
EVENT—if the job also has the WAITON attribute and has not been
released by its master jobs
•
TAPE—if the job requires more tape drives than are available and has
been released by its master jobs (if any)
•
READY—if all the preceding conditions are satisfied
